The Legal Responsibilities and Duties of Premises Liability Attorneys
Premises liability attorneys play a critical role in the legal landscape by advocating for clients who have suffered injuries due to dangerous or hazardous conditions on another’s property. These legal professionals specialize in holding property owners accountable for negligence, which can lead to serious accidents such as slips, trips, and falls. The primary responsibility of these attorneys is to establish that the property owner failed to ensure a safe environment, which subsequently caused harm to the client.
In premises liability cases, attorneys must adeptly manage several legal responsibilities, including gathering evidence, interviewing witnesses, and consulting with experts. They must prove that a dangerous condition existed, that the property owner knew or should have known about it, and that the condition directly caused the client’s injuries. By meticulously handling these duties, premises liability attorneys strive to secure fair comp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and emotional distress incurred by the injured party.

Examples of Common Premises Liability Cases
Premises liability cases encompass a variety of scenarios. Slip and fall accidents are perhaps the most common form of liability cases, occurring when individuals sustain injuries due to wet floors, uneven surfaces, or poor lighting. In such cases, premises liability attorneys utilize evidence from building codes, maintenance logs, and witness testimonies to establish that the property owner was negligent in addressing potential hazards.
Inadequate security leading to incidents, such as assaults or theft, also falls under premises liability. Here, attorneys gather evidence of insufficient safety measures like broken locks, poor lighting, or a lack of surveillance systems. They argue that such negligence directly contributed to their client’s harm, compelling property owners to compensate for damages suffered.

Asking the Right Questions
To ensure you are making an informed decision, there are several key questions you should consider asking prospective premises liability attorneys:
- How many years have you been practicing premises liability law?
- Can you provide examples of cases similar to mine that you have handled?
- What is your approach to building a strong case for clients?
- How do you keep clients informed about the progress of their case?
- What is your fee structure, and are there any additional costs I should be aware of?
The responses to these questions will provide clarity on the attorney’s experience and help you determine if they are the best fit for handling your case.
